    Abstract: A method for forming a semiconductor device structure is provided. The method includes forming an interconnect structure over a substrate. The method includes forming a first conductive pad and a mask layer over the interconnect structure. The mask layer covers a top surface of the first conductive pad. The method includes forming a metal oxide layer over a sidewall of the first conductive pad. The method includes forming a second conductive pad over the first conductive pad and passing through the mask layer. The first conductive pad and the second conductive pad are made of different materials.

    Abstract: An electronic device including a first body, an input module and a functional element is provided. The input module is movably disposed on the first body and adapted to be moved between a first position and a second position. The functional element is disposed on the input module. When the input module is located at the first position, the functional element is concealed in the first body. When the input module is located at the second position, the functional element is exposed outside the first body.

    Abstract: A docking station, an electronic apparatus and a portable device are provided. The electronic apparatus comprises a portable device having a display surface and a docking station having a base and a connecting module. The base has a supporting surface. The portable device is adapted to be attached to the supporting surface. The connecting module has a first pivot and a second pivot. The first pivot is connected and pivoted to the base, and the second pivot is detachably pivoted to the portable device, such that the portable device is adapted to rotate relatively to the docking station.

    Abstract: An electronic apparatus including a portable device and a docking station is provided. The portable device has a display surface and a first restricting element. The docking station includes a base and a frame. The base has a supporting surface, wherein the portable device is adapted to be placed on the supporting surface. The frame is disposed around the base and has a second restricting element, wherein the frame is adapted to slide related to the base to drive the second restricting element to be aligned to the first restricting element of the portable device placed on the supporting surface, such that the portable device is fixed to the base by means of a magnetic attraction force between the first restricting element and the second restricting element.

    Abstract: An electronic apparatus including a portable device and a docking station is provided. The portable device has a display surface and the first restricting element. The docking station includes a base having a supporting surface and the second restricting element disposed on the supporting surface. The first restricting element is latched to the second restricting element when the portable device is attached to the supporting surface. Besides, the portable device is adapted to stand on the base by restricting the relative position of the portable device and the second restricting element.

    Abstract: A body temperature monitoring device includes a processor unit connected electrically to a temperature detecting unit, a data storage unit, a display unit, and a control key unit. The control key unit is operable so as to control the processor unit to store periodically both temperature information corresponding to a digital temperature signal from the temperature detecting unit, and storage time information associated with the temperature information in the data storage unit. The control key unit is further operable to control the processor unit to retrieve the temperature information and the storage time information from the data storage unit, and to enable the processor unit to control the display unit to show the temperature information and the storage time information.
